Greek For 1807
Word exaireo
Pronunciation ex-ahee-reh'-o
Definition from 1537 and 138; actively, to tear out; middle voice, to select; figuratively, to release:

deliver, pluck out, rescue.
Root(s) 1537  138  
Verse Occurrences 8
